Description: Location. The Bosnia National Monument Muslibegovic House is located in Mostar, Bosnia and Herzegovina, 300 metres from the reconstructed Mostar Bridge and five kilometres from the UNESCO site of Tekija. Mostar Airport is seven kilometres away.
Hotel Features. Dating from the end of the 17th Century, the property was home to the Muslibegovic family who ruled much of Herzegovinia and maintain political influence today. Opened as a hotel in 2006, the house is one of Mostar's main tourist sites with exhibits of Ottoman calligraphy and other artefacts of cultural importance. Modern amenities combine sympathetically with original features and decor, maintaining the property's historic atmosphere. Expert Tip. The Muslim holy site of Tekija was built in the 16th Century during the reign of the Mostar Mufti, Ziauddin-Ahmed Ibn Mustafa. Natural springs flow out of nearby cliffs to form the scenic Buna River.

Description: This property is part of the Muslibegovic estate, a family of considerable stature in Herzegovina. Exhibited in the house are some fascinating historical artefacts including the preserved original building permit, manuscripts and letters from the Ottoman period and some wonderful examples of Ottoman calligraphy. Witness Bosnian cultural relics and crafts up close in the form of hand made handkerchiefs, purses, blankets and clothes. There are also a number of precious books written in Turkish, Persian and Arabic.
